Revisionist History

Thomas L. Mcdonald

O.R.B. version 1.04 offers an attractive set of enhancements along with a few fixes that improve overall gameplay. At the top of the bill is a spiffy 3D tactical screen, which replaces the crummy old 2D one. Four new playable units (two frigates for each race) have arrived on the scene, along with one new alien carrier each for the Kyulek and Elathan. Eight skirmish and multiplayer scenarios, a few weapons, and some fresh sound effects round out the slate of additions. The capital-ship limit is up to 20, and the build screen now has a Pause function.

On the maintenance side of things, multiplayer stability is significantly improved, with code enhancements implemented to make O.R.B. run more smoothly. The loading time is (thankfully) better, but whether or not it reaches the ��200 percent faster�� claims of Strategy First is up for debate. That��s not really something you can quantify across all computers. The company is also touting better A.I. and improved explosions. On the first count, the A.I. does seem a little better, or maybe it��s just cheating better. Good A.I. is like Justice Stewart��s famous definition of pornography����I know it when I see it����but O.R.B.��s A.I. pulls the plow. On the second count, why yes, explosions do look a bit more explosiony.

If you toddle on over to the official site (www.o-r-b.com), you��ll also find the second package of three new maps by the Phoenix, along with a 1.04 upgrade to his first map pack.

Vietcong version 1.01 claims a ��significantly�� improved framerate. ��Significantly�� is another one of the unquantifiable words in PC gaming, since everyone has a different notion of what ��significant improvement�� is. Vietcong could really use an improvement that a reasonable person might call ��significant�� or even ��adequate.�� I��d call v.1.01 a ��marginal�� improvement. The Pterodon engine still kicks few asses and takes down no names whatsoever.

While framerate was by far the most serious problem dogging Vietcong, there are a few other fixes in the patch: no more respawning inside another player during multiplayer, a functional team autokick option, and supposedly better cheat protection, though I couldn��t verify this last improvement.
